Who Lives in Valletta Waterfront / Grand Harbour View?
Finance professionals commuting to Sliema, cruise industry workers, harbour-view enthusiasts.
Living in Valletta Waterfront / Grand Harbour View — Practical Details
Walkability
Good — waterfront restaurants and ferry terminal walkable; uphill to city centre
Grocery & Food Access
Limited — waterfront restaurants; grocery shopping requires walk uphill or ferry to Sliema
Getting Around
- Sliema ferry (10 min)
- Barrakka Lift to Upper Barrakka Gardens
- Bus from City Gate
Nearby Coworking
- HUB Valletta (10 min walk uphill)
- Sliema coworking (ferry, 10 min)
Insider Tips for Valletta Waterfront / Grand Harbour View
- 1Grand Harbour views are genuinely among the world's great urban panoramas — worth every euro
- 2The Barrakka Lift (free) connects the waterfront to the Upper Barrakka — your daily commute is an elevator with a view
- 3Waterfront apartments are in high demand — expect to compete with short-term rental investors
- 4The Three Cities across the harbour (Birgu, Senglea, Cospicua) are worth exploring by ferry — emerging and cheaper
